Our verdict is Likely benign. Variant got -2 ACMG points: 2P and 4B. PM2BP4_Strong
The NM_024713.3(KATNBL1):c.272G>T(p.Gly91Val) variant causes a missense change involving the alteration of a non-conserved nucleotide.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.0000756 in 1,613,978 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, with no homozygous occurrence. In-silico tool predicts a benign outcome for this variant. 15/20 in silico tools predict a benign outcome for this variant. No clinical diagnostic laboratories have submitted clinical-significance assessments for this variant to ClinVar.

Uncertain significance, criteria provided, single submitter | clinical testing | Ambry Genetics | Aug 07, 2024 | The c.272G>T (p.G91V) alteration is located in exon 4 (coding exon 3) of the KATNBL1 gene. This alteration results from a G to T substitution at nucleotide position 272, causing the glycine (G) at amino acid position 91 to be replaced by a valine (V). Based on insufficient or conflicting evidence, the clinical significance of this alteration remains unclear. - |
